Uncategorized

Как работает интернет: от требования до скачивания страницы

Как работает интернет: от требования до скачивания страницы

Каждый день миллионы людей запускают браузеры и приобретают доступ к информации. Процесс загрузки веб-страницы представляется мгновенным, но за этим стоит последовательность технических действий. Она включает преобразование адреса онлайн казино, установление связи с отдалённым компьютером, отправку данных и отображение контента. Понимание этих шагов способствует осознать, как организована всемирная сеть.

Что происходит в момент, когда набирается адрес сайта

Пользователь набирает адрес в строку браузера и нажимает клавишу ввода. Браузер приступает обрабатывание запроса с анализа набранной строки. Программа сверяет, является ли текст верным адресом или поисковым запросом. Если строка включает точки и соответствует структуре веб-адреса, браузер интерпретирует её как URL.

После установления категории требования браузер разбирает адрес на составные компоненты. Адрес содержит протокол передачи информации, доменное имя и путь к странице. Протокол указывает вариант обмена сведениями. Доменное имя представляет символьное название ресурса в сети.

Браузер проверяет личную память на присутствие сохранённых данных о ресурсе. Кэш может содержать копии файлов, что убыстряет скачивание. Если информация актуальна, браузер применяет сохранённые данные. 10 лучших казино онлайн зависит от параметров кэширования и момента последнего взаимодействия к ресурсу.

Как система доменных имён способствует отыскать требуемый сервер

Компьютеры в сети обмениваются сведениями, используя цифровые адреса. Человеку сложно удерживать ряды цифр, поэтому была создана система доменных имён. Эта система конвертирует символьные названия в численные коды, доступные сетевому оборудованию.

Когда браузер извлекает доменное имя, он обращается к особым серверам DNS. Запрос идёт через несколько ступеней. Корневые серверы перенаправляют запрос к серверам зон главного уровня. Те перенаправляют запрос к авторитетным серверам конкретного домена.

Авторитетный сервер возвращает цифровой адрес требуемого ресурса. Браузер записывает сведения в внутреннем кэше. При вторичном запросе браузер применяет записанные данные, что уменьшает период обработки. онлайн казино осуществляется за части секунды, но включает массу промежуточных шагов между разными серверами.

Соединение между адресом сайта и цифровым адресом устройства

Доменное имя служит комфортным обозначением для юзеров. Цифровой адрес являет уникальный идентификатор устройства в сети. Система DNS формирует соединение между символьным названием и числовым параметром. Один домен может подходить нескольким адресам, если ресурс находится на разных серверах. Такая архитектура обеспечивает надёжность деятельности сетевых служб.

Создание соединения: как устройства обмениваются импульсами

После извлечения цифрового адреса браузер начинает соединение с сервером. Устройства передают особыми сигналами для создания канала связи. Клиент передаёт обращение на подключение. Сервер получает требование и передаёт подтверждение готовности к взаимодействию информацией.

Клиент извлекает подтверждение и передаёт завершающий команду. Этот трёхэтапный взаимодействие зовётся рукопожатием. Механизм гарантирует готовность обеих сторон к пересылке сведений. После финализации формируется устойчивый путь для передачи информацией.

Для безопасных подключений осуществляются вспомогательные действия. Устройства согласовывают параметры шифрования и передают ключами. Сервер передаёт цифровой сертификат. 10 лучших казино онлайн сверяет сертификат и устанавливает зашифрованный путь, защищающий информацию от захвата.

Отправка информации: как данные движется от сервера к юзеру

После установления связи стартует пересылка данных. Браузер посылает HTTP-запрос, включающий данные о необходимом ресурсе. Обращение охватывает способ обращения, путь к файлу и вспомогательные настройки. Сервер обрабатывает требование и формирует реакцию.

Сведения передаются небольшими частями, называемыми пакетами. Каждый пакет содержит фрагмент данных и технические сведения для маршрутизации. Пакеты следуют через ряд переходных точек сети. Маршрутизаторы направляют пакеты к получателю, подбирая эффективные пути.

Клиент собирает пакеты в верном порядке и контролирует полноту сведений. Если пакеты утрачены или испорчены, инициируется повторная передача. онлайн казино гарантирует надёжную передачу сведений. Протоколы передачи контролируют скорость пересылки, адаптируясь к транспортной ёмкости пути связи.

Почему безопасное связь представляет важность

Криптование охраняет сведения от несанкционированного доступа. Хакеры не могут расшифровать закодированную информацию при захвате. Безопасное соединение казино онлайн удостоверяет подлинность сервера. Пользователи могут защищённо пересылать личные информацию и платёжную данные.

Сервер и его ответ: как создаётся контент страницы

Сервер принимает требование от браузера и приступает процесс. Программное обеспечение изучает маршрут к искомому ресурсу. Если запрашивается статический файл, сервер извлекает его из файловой системы. Фиксированные файлы содержат изображения, таблицы стилей и завершённые документы.

Для динамических страниц сервер выполняет программный код. Код апеллирует к базам данных для получения релевантной данных. Сервер объединяет сведения из различных источников и формирует HTML-документ. Процесс генерации зависит от трудности запроса и объёма сведений.

После создания контента сервер формирует HTTP-ответ. Реакция содержит код состояния, заголовки и содержимое сообщения. Заголовки включают метаинформацию о пересылаемом наполнении. казино онлайн посылает сформированный ответ обратно получателю по установленному подключению.

Из чего состоит веб-страница

Веб-страница представляет собой набор отличающихся файлов и элементов. Базу составляет HTML-документ, определяющий организацию и наполнение. HTML применяет теги для форматирования текста, заголовков и других элементов. Документ хранит ссылки на добавочные ресурсы.

Таблицы стилей CSS управляют за графическое представление страницы. Стили задают палитру, шрифты, размеры и позиционирование элементов. Один файл стилей может применяться к массе страниц. JavaScript добавляет интерактивность и изменяемое функционирование. Скрипты анализируют операции клиента и трансформируют содержимое без перезагрузки.

Изображения, видео и аудиофайлы обогащают письменное контент. Шрифты могут загружаться независимо для требуемого представления текста. 10 лучших казино онлайн извлекает все нужные компоненты после получения базового HTML-документа, формируя завершённую изображение страницы.

Как браузер обрабатывает и отображает содержимое

Браузер принимает HTML-документ и приступает структурный парсинг. Программа строка за строкой читает код и создаёт древовидную архитектуру компонентов. Эта организация зовётся элементной представлением документа. Каждый тег преобразуется точкой дерева, связанным с главными и подчинёнными узлами.

Одновременно браузер анализирует таблицы стилей. Программа задействует инструкции дизайна к соответствующим элементам. Рассчитываются габариты, расположения и визуальные параметры каждого блока. Браузер создаёт дерево визуализации, связывающее структуру и оформление.

На очередном этапе происходит размещение частей. Браузер вычисляет точные координаты и размеры каждого блока. После завершения вычислений стартует визуализация. онлайн казино рисует пиксели на экран, создавая видимое изображение. При подгрузке добавочных элементов браузер освежает визуализацию.

Роль структуры страницы, дизайна и динамических компонентов

HTML определяет логическую структуру наполнения и структуру элементов. CSS формирует зрительную привлекательность и улучшает понимание сведений. JavaScript предоставляет отклик на манипуляции пользователя. Комбинация трёх инструментов генерирует работоспособные веб-интерфейсы. Разделение архитектуры онлайн казино, дизайна и поведения ускоряет построение ресурсов.

Почему быстрота скачивания страниц может отличаться

Быстрота подгрузки зависит от ряда обстоятельств. Пропускная способность интернет-соединения сказывается на время передачи данных. Слабое связь повышает длительность загрузки файлов. Расстояние между пользователем и сервером также имеет важность. Чем отдалённее расположен сервер, тем больше времени требуется для передачи команды.

Габарит и количество элементов на странице воздействуют на итоговое длительность загрузки. Страницы с множеством изображений и скриптов скачиваются дольше. Улучшение файлов снижает размер пересылаемых информации. Компрессия графики и оптимизация кода ускоряют подгрузку.

Мощность сервера устанавливает скорость процесса требований. Занятый сервер медленнее формирует ответы. казино онлайн может испытывать торможения при значительной активности. Качество маршрутизации сказывается на время передачи пакетов.

Хранение сведений и распределение трафика: как ускоряется подключение к ресурсам

Для увеличения доступа используются системы кэширования. Переходные серверы хранят копии часто востребованных элементов. Когда пользователь направляется к ресурсу, запрос анализируется соседним промежуточным сервером. Это сокращает расстояние пересылки сведений и понижает нагрузку.

Сети доставки содержимого размещают реплики ресурсов на серверах по глобальному миру. Юзеры извлекают данные от географически ближайшего сервера. Такая организация сокращает задержки и повышает быстроту загрузки. Размещение контента эффективно для статических файлов: картинок, стилей и скриптов.

Балансировщики нагрузки разделяют запросы между разными серверами. Если один сервер загружен, запросы направляются к меньше занятым серверам. казино онлайн обеспечивает устойчивую работу при значительном трафике. Дублирование усиливает стабильность: при сбое одного сервера запросы перенаправляются к функционирующим узлам.

Как манипуляции пользователя влияют на скачивание страницы

Манипуляции юзера прямо влияют на процедуру загрузки. Щелчок по гиперссылке порождает свежий запрос к серверу. Браузер возобновляет процесс: конвертацию адреса, установление соединения и получение информации. Ввод форм и передача информации создают дополнительные обращения.

Скроллинг страницы может активировать загрузку дополнительных компонентов. Метод отложенной скачивания загружает графику по мере необходимости. Такой подход убыстряет начальную подгрузку и экономит трафик. Активные элементы реагируют на перемещения указателя, исполняя скрипты и трансформируя содержимое.

Параметры браузера влияют на функционирование при скачивании. Отключение JavaScript останавливает запуск скриптов. Блокировщики рекламы останавливают подгрузку специфических ресурсов. 10 лучших казино онлайн может записывать параметры пользователя, сказывающиеся на показ наполнения и темп работы ресурса.